In 1987 I became one of the founder members of International Marconi Day. This
event is normally held on the Saturday nearest to April 24th [Marconi's birthday].
There will be approximately 50 official stations taking part from locations around
the globe where Marconi carried out his numerous experiments.
We hold a mobile Rally each July when we provide the venue,Penair School,Truro,
for traders to set up their stalls and sell their wares normally linked to amateur radio
and computing but anything goes if we have the space.
Catering is provided too and as much as anything its a social event to allow us to
meet the voices we speak to regularly face to face.
